"Spinning Petals" is the name of the art installation piece I created for the Santa Barbara Botanic Garden Backcountry Casitas program - a dispersed collection of interactive environments to engage child visitors the Garden and encourage imaginative play. Here's a video about it. My piece is a collection of six petal or leaf shaped hemp fabric sculptures over welded steel frames that spin when pushed or in the wind. The surface treatments are a virtual sampler of textile art mark making from painting, stamping, stencils, dye, applique, and embroidery. My goal was to create a vividly colorful space that would attract the viewers interest from a distance while highlighting the textures and images of nature reflecting the local flora. The patterns are either from oversized flower petals or life sized bay leaves, while one petal showcases natural dyes including avocado, and transfer images from flowers including nasturtium and milkweed.
